首页文章正文

c结构体转json字符串,用json方便还是结构体方便

如何把结构体转换成字符串 2023-12-12 20:30 979 墨鱼
如何把结构体转换成字符串

c结构体转json字符串,用json方便还是结构体方便

c结构体转json字符串,用json方便还是结构体方便

(=`′=) 2.根据结构体内容,根据规则重新定义两个函数,将结构体对象序列化为JSON对象,并将JSON对象反序列化为结构体对象。 staticcJSON*s​​truct_to_json(void*cJSON*array;intvalue_int;intarray_len;inti=0;char*value_string;//解析json1//通过cJSON_Parse解析收到的字符串,然后通过cJSON_GetObjectItem获取指定key的值,最后释放JSON结

使用xpack::json::encode将结构转换为json。使用xpack::json::decode将json转换为结构。#include#include"xpack/json.h"//Json包含这个头文件,和xml包含步骤1:定义C++类结构首先,我们需要定义一个C++类或结构来描述我们想要转换为json数据的对象。 例如,这里有一个简单的示例结构:structPerson{std::

●▂● 如何将结构体转换为jsoninc++_UsecJSONtocreateJSONstring操作结果structJsonDumpInterface{//ConvertJsonObjecttomodelfieldvirtualvoidfromJson(constQJsonObject&jsonObject){}virtual~JsonDumpInterface()=default;};//Model类继承这个Interface:str

//将结构体Student类型变量student转换为acJSON对象cJSON*json_student=struct_to_json(&student);//输出无格式的jsonstringchar*json_string=cJSON_P1,struct//发送信息格式typedefstructSend_Info{intcode;//接口标识QMapmsg;QMapdata;}sendInfo;2. 填充结构QDatem_date=

后台-插件-广告管理-内容页尾部广告(手机)

标签: 用json方便还是结构体方便

发表评论

评论列表

黑豹加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号